Our utility room is not big - approx 6'6 x 8' DH reckons.

Have a small cupboard, wahing machine and dryer down one side with a work top above, and a shelve on wall above that. Has a door in and then an external door out to garden. Enough room to stand an airer. If airer is down enough room to iron.

Ours is 8x12' contains wm, sink/drainer, freezer, tumbledryer, fridge/freezer and the ironing board is permanently up ! Also have a ceiling mounted drying rack. tbh we fill the space because it is there, has become a haven for clutter and ironing, and it feels disproportionate to the rest of the house.
